Sub Miniature Pressure Sensor for Harsh Environment
The PHE860 series is designed to operate in the harshest environments, including wide operating temperature, mechanical shocks and vibrations
- Available with 0,5-4,5Vdc output
- Operating from -40 to +140°C
- Ultra light sensor : 3 grams
- Large Bandwidth
The PHE860 series is designed to operate in the harshest environments, including wide operating temperature, mechanical shocks and vibrations. It is well adapted to embedded measurements, on vehicules, aircrafts, satellites, robots, missiles or on test benches for any equipement where space and mass are at a premium. With pressure ranges available from -1 up to 250 bar, its all stainless steel construction makes it usable with most fluids used in industry, even corrosive ones. The PHE860 is manufactured with the ruggedized and proprietary sensitive elements and components developed by EFE. Its manufacturing process, including traceable controls and special burn-in, gives the best insurance of high performances and stability in the most challenging applications.
